Slice of Saugatuck Returns on Sunday

The third annual Slice of Saugatuck Festival will be held on Sunday September 14, from 1-4 pm (rain date Sept. 21). The family friendly Wine & Food and Retail Experience has once again expanded, both in the number of participating venues and what is being offered to the festival goer, especially kids. Activities will include tastings at over two dozen eateries, great offerings by all the other merchants, a mini maker space, drones, obstacle courses, bouncy houses, magicians, hula hoops and rock climbing. Also added this year, will be a retrospective of historic Saugatuck created by the Town curator Kathie Bennewitz which will feature many old photos of the area, historic items and a copy of the, currently being restored, Saugatuck Mural by Robert Lambdin.


The Homes with Hope Gillespie Food Pantry will again be the beneficiary. Tickets, with a passport to take around for tastes are $10 per adult and $5 for Children 6-12. For information, a list of merchants and a map of the event go to: www.westportwestonchamber.com/saugatuck
